mysql聚合函数 group by和order by等
2021/10/27 19:39:49
本文主要是介绍mysql聚合函数 group by和order by等,对大家解决编程问题具有一定的参考价值,需要的程序猿们随着小编来一起学习吧!
1、select与group by 统计数据类型(种类)
2、求和(sum);
(1)float
(2)、decimal(p,s)
p指的是所有数字的长度。s是小数点后面的数字的长度。比如decimal(10,2),所有数字一共最多有10位,小数点后面的数字最多两位。
3、平均值(avg)
使用命令:select avg(salary) as 平均薪资 from worker;。
4、求最大值(max)
使用命令:select max(salary) as 最大值薪资 from worker;。
5、求最小值(min)
使用命令:select min(salary) as 最小值薪资 from worker;。
6、排序(order by)
(1)、从高到底排序(desc)
(2)、从低到高排序
(3)、order by也可以与group by连用。
7、去除重复的信息(distinct)
使用distinct的前提:先给表里添加一条与原表重复的信息,这样才能看出效果。
使用命令:select distinct title from worker;
8、过滤(having)
通过having来过滤group by自居的结果信息。
这篇关于mysql聚合函数 group by和order by等的文章就介绍到这儿,希望我们推荐的文章对大家有所帮助,也希望大家多多支持为之网!
- 2024-12-07MySQL读写分离入门:轻松掌握数据库读写分离技术
- 2024-12-07MySQL读写分离入门教程
- 2024-12-07MySQL分库分表入门详解
- 2024-12-07MySQL分库分表入门指南
- 2024-12-07MySQL慢查询入门:快速掌握性能优化技巧
- 2024-12-07MySQL入门:新手必读的简单教程
- 2024-12-07MySQL入门:从零开始学习MySQL数据库
- 2024-12-07MySQL索引入门:新手快速掌握MySQL索引技巧
- 2024-12-06BinLog学习:MySQL数据库BinLog入门教程
- 2024-12-06Binlog学习:MySQL数据库的日志管理入门教程